A powerful English queen inspires a brilliant Robert Off roombox. by Deb Weissler When many people think about powerful English queens, Elizabeth I is likely the first to come to mind. There’s no denying Elizabeth I is revered as one of the greatest English monarchs to have ever ruled, but 400 years earlier, Eleanor of Aquitane helped rule a dynasty that ensured her place among the prominent European families. One of the most powerful and influential women of her time, she would become queen of France, queen of England, help lead a crusade to the Holy Land, and give birth to three kings, two queens, and numerous counts and countesses.
